How to survive the flight to Sparta?
If you're not prepared, travelling can be testing. But there's no need to panic. Follow these tips and tricks for a pain-free start to your holiday in Sparta.What to pack in your hand luggage:
  • The secret to having a great flight experience is to plan ahead. So, let's start with the basics: passport, official ID, credit cards and important medications. Next, bring on board items that'll help keep you busy, like some electronic devices or a magazine. You'll also want to bring your chargers,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of earplugs. Last but not least, be sure to chuck in toiletries like a toothbrush, facial wipes and a clean T-shirt.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:
  • While the list of banned items differs between airlines, the general guide to follow is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, pocket knives, aerosol cans and bleaching agents. Sporting equipment like ski poles, and objects that could harm passengers, such as pepper spray and firearms, are also banned from the cabin.

What to wear on a flight:
  • The narrow aisles of your plane are not the place for a fashion parade. Wear comfortable clothes and take a sweater as it can get chilly inside the cabin during long-haul flights. Closed-toed, flat shoes are also a good idea.
  • The condition by the name of DVT (deep vein thrombosis) can pose a risk on long-haul flights. It results from blood clots forming due to poor circulation. Walking up and down the aisle and doing leg and foot exercises while seated helps to prevent this from happening. Wearing a high-quality pair of compression tights or socks can also help.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Sparta?
The answer is simple --- be organised. We've rounded up some handy tips and tricks for a stress-free trip through airport security. Watch out Sparta, here you come:
  • Be sure to keep your passport and travel documents easily accessible. They'll be the first things you'll be asked to show at airport security.
  • Time to strip down. Well kind of. Your coat, belt, keys and other small items, like coins,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them before your turn.
  • All electronic gadgets, including your phone and laptop, will also need to be scanned.
  • Travelling with your favourite cologne or perfume? No problem. As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it's stored in a zip-lock bag, you're permitted to bring it with you in your carry-on baggage.
  • There's a chance you'll need to remove your shoes for scanning,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a smart idea.
  • Sharp items such as knives and scissors are not allowed in the cabin. They'll be confiscated at security, so put them in your checked baggage.
